Boulder City, NV
Clark County
Boulder City does not require STR liability insurance because STRs are banned citywide. Long-term landlords should carry standard landlord or rental dwelling policies.

Clark County
North Las Vegas requires a minimum of 500,000 dollars in liability insurance for licensed short-term rentals. Proof must be provided at application and maintained continuously while the Conditional Use Permit is active.

Boulder City FAQ
Do I need short-term rental insurance in Boulder City?
No, because STRs are banned. Long-term landlords should carry a standard landlord policy and ensure their homeowners insurance allows rental use.
What insurance is typical in Nevada cities that allow STRs?
Under AB 363, many Nevada jurisdictions require at least 500,000 dollars of liability coverage per STR. Boulder City does not, since STRs are prohibited.
North Las Vegas FAQ
How much STR insurance do I need in North Las Vegas?
A minimum of 500,000 dollars in liability coverage under Ordinance 3127. Proof must be filed with the city and maintained continuously while the permit is active.
Does my regular homeowners policy count?
Usually not. Standard homeowners policies often exclude commercial rental activity. Most hosts need a dedicated short-term rental endorsement or commercial liability policy.
